Generally speaking when you send to a Google list, you as the sender don't get a copy of what you sent, they figure that you already know what you sent so why waste the bandwidth. I know that I found all the test emails yesterday rather annoying, my preference is to wait until I have something to say and then figure out if the system is working, but for me it's a nice to have rather than a must have or life and death importance newsgroup. Other things to consider: Are you sending from the same email account that you registered into the Google Group with? Many of us have multiple email accounts and after a while we forget that they are different.
